Current Flight Trends
As of October 2023, Madrid-Barajas Airport (MAD) has seen a substantial increase in flight operations, with airlines reinstating routes that were previously suspended. According to recent data, more than 200 daily flights are operating to and from the airport, connecting Madrid with cities across Europe, North America, and beyond. Major airlines such as Iberia, British Airways, and Lufthansa are offering competitive prices and expanded schedules.
The European travel market has also witnessed significant recovery, with leisure travel making a strong comeback. Reports indicate that flights originating from London, Paris, and Frankfurt to Madrid are among the busiest routes. Budget airlines, such as Ryanair and EasyJet, have contributed to making these flights more accessible, offering lower fares and more frequent services.

Travel Tips
For travellers planning to book flights to Madrid, it is advisable to compare prices across different platforms and consider flexible travel dates for better deals. Additionally, flying midweek often results in lower prices compared to weekend departures. With airport security measures still in place, it is essential to arrive early to navigate the check-in and security processes efficiently.
